Google Talk lags in worldwide IM metrics

comScore Media did a survey on the number of unique connections to the various IM servers and Google Talk ranked lower among the popular IM services like AIM, Yahoo! and MSN. Google Talk was ranked lower than E-Messenger.Net and Paltalk. It should be noted that this survey was conducted in the month of May. MSN messenger was on top of the pack with 203,902 unique visitors (a 9% increase from last year).

The stats that got to me most was that Rediff Bol Instant Messenger was listed in this chart (2,647) above Trillian. Now that MSN messenger and Yahoo! messenger users can see each other on their network it will be interesting on how they perform next year.
